When ever i plug in the batteries to my maxx it dosnt work... but when i plug the batteries in half way it works. waht could be the problem? :shrug:

If you are still using the old style Tamiya connectors, trash them. They can heat up to the point of melting, the resistance will rob you of valuable power and occasionally give you problems like what you're experiencing. I use the Deans connectors. Ask around about the Deans. They're hard to beat.
